Abstract
A data processing terminal device is on-line connected to a host computer and records on journal paper journal data obtained as a result of communication with the host computer. Data is encrypted, and encrypted data is exchanged between the terminal device and the host computer. An IC card connected to the terminal device receives the encrypted data from the host computer, decrypts the data, modifies it and records the data on a recording medium. The terminal device records decrypted data on a journal paper. By comparing the journal data with it's modified data recorded on the IC card, journal data alteration can be easily detected.
